Product catalog summary
Specifications:
The Fiber Output Laser Diode Bar Module L15856-01 operates with a center emission wavelength of 940 nm and a radiant power of 240 W. It features a fiber core diameter of 400 µm and is equipped with a built-in photodiode for radiant power monitoring. The module uses a water cooling method that does not require pure water, with a cooling water temperature of 25°C and a flow rate of 3.0 L/min.
Absolute Maximum Ratings:
Key parameters include a forward current of 60 A, reverse voltage of 2 V, and operating ambient temperature range of +15 to +35°C. The storage temperature range is -5 to +50°C, and the humidity inside the chassis should not exceed 35%.
Applications:
This module is suitable for exciting solid-state lasers and selective laser heating applications.
Features:
The module can output information on the temperature of its built-in laser diode, humidity in the package, and leakage through a D-sub connector. It is equipped with a leakage sensor and uses distilled water for cooling.
Cooling Conditions:
The cooling system requires distilled water with a temperature of +25°C and a flow rate between 3.0 to 3.5 L/min. The cooling water hose has an outer diameter of 8 mm.
Pinout:
The module uses a D-sub 25-pin male connector for power input, temperature sensors, and leakage sensors. Specific pins are designated for power input, photodiode connections, and temperature data output.
Safety and Compliance:
The product is classified as a Class 4 laser product under IEC 60825-1: 2014, indicating that it emits invisible laser radiation that can be hazardous to eyes and skin. Users must follow safety regulations to avoid exposure.

Fiber Output Laser Diode Bar Module L15856-01 ■ Features ● Radiant power: 240 W ● Fiber core diameter: 400 µm ● Capable of outputting laser diodes (LD) temperature and humidity in the package ● Equipped with a leakage sensor ● Built-in photodiode (PD) for radiant power monitor ■ Applications ● Exciting a solid state laser ● Selective laser heating ■ Outline This is a fiber output LD bar module using 940 nm LD bars. It can output the information of temperature of its built-in LD, humidity in the package, leakage and radiant power through D-sub connector.
